Dow and Univar Solutions Expand Access to Low-Carbon Products Through Strategic Agreement
  • 27.07.2026

Dow and Univar Solutions announced a long-term agreement to offer and distribute Dow's Decarbia low-carbon products with Product Carbon Footprint (PCF) certificates across key markets including beauty and personal care, home care, food, pharmaceuticals and various industrial performance segments.

The companies said the agreement expands customer access to low-carbon products through Univar Solutions' global distribution network, helping address growing demand and supporting customers' Scope 3 emissions reduction targets.

Dow stated that the carbon footprints of these products are calculated using its Carbon Footprint Ledger methodology, which is limited assured under international PCF standards including ISO 14067 and the GHG Protocol Product Standard.

Dow executive Brendy Lange said the agreement deepens collaboration with Univar Solutions and combines Dow's low-carbon product portfolio and verifiable PCF data with Univar's distribution reach to help customers pursue sustainability goals with confidence. Univar Solutions CEO David Jukes said the partnership broadens access to low-carbon products and provides more impactful supply chain alternatives across its customer base.

Both companies said they continue investing in sustainable solutions and capabilities in response to growing demand for low-carbon products. They described the agreement as the next step in a longstanding collaboration aimed at supporting both near-term and long-term sustainability goals.
